If your Honda GCV160 engine starts but then dies almost immediately, you’re likely dealing with a faulty governor assembly—a frustrating but common issue that can bring lawn care, pressure washing, or small equipment operation to a grinding halt. The governor plays a critical role in regulating engine speed by controlling the throttle based on load changes. When it fails, the engine may fire up briefly but can’t sustain idle or respond properly to demand, leading to stalling. 1. Compatibility with GCV160 Engine Model
Not all governor assemblies are created equal—and not all are designed for the Honda GCV160. This engine is used in a wide range of equipment, including lawn mowers, pressure washers, generators, and tillers, and even small variations in model numbers (like GCV160A, GCV160LA, or GCV160LE) can affect part compatibility. Before purchasing, verify your engine’s exact model and serial number, which are typically stamped on a metal tag near the carburetor or flywheel. Cross-referencing this information with the manufacturer’s specifications ensures you’re getting a part that fits correctly and functions as intended.
Using an incompatible governor can lead to improper throttle response, erratic idling, or complete engine failure. For example, a governor designed for a GCV190 may have different spring tension or linkage geometry, causing the throttle to open too quickly or not enough. Always double-check fitment charts provided by reputable suppliers. Many top-tier brands include detailed compatibility lists, and some even offer online tools to help you confirm the right part. When in doubt, consult your owner’s manual or contact the manufacturer directly.

4. Performance Specifications
The governor’s job is to maintain a consistent engine speed under varying loads, so its performance characteristics are crucial. Key specs to consider include spring tension, response time, and throttle range. The GCV160 typically operates at a governed speed of around 3,600 RPM under load, and the governor must react quickly to prevent overspeed or stalling.
Spring tension determines how aggressively the governor responds to load changes. A properly tensioned spring ensures smooth acceleration and deceleration without hunting (rapid RPM fluctuations). If the spring is too weak, the engine may bog down under load; if too strong, it may overspeed or fail to idle properly. Some aftermarket governors allow for spring adjustment, which can be useful for fine-tuning performance, but this requires mechanical skill and should only be attempted by experienced users.
Response time refers to how quickly the governor reacts to changes in engine load. A slow response can cause hesitation or stalling, especially when starting or under sudden load (like engaging a mower blade). High-quality governors use precision linkages and low-friction pivots to ensure rapid, accurate adjustments. While this is difficult to measure without specialized tools, user reviews and expert testing can provide insights into real-world performance.
5. Ease of Installation
Even the best governor assembly is useless if it’s difficult to install. The GCV160 governor is typically mounted near the carburetor and connected to the throttle linkage via a series of rods, springs, and clips. Installation requires removing the air filter, carburetor, and sometimes the flywheel cover, so it’s not a beginner-friendly job. However, some assemblies are designed for easier installation, with pre-assembled linkages, clear instructions, or alignment guides.
Look for kits that include all necessary hardware—springs, clips, washers, and gaskets—so you don’t have to scavenge parts or make multiple trips to the hardware store. Some premium kits even come with step-by-step video tutorials or QR codes linking to installation guides. If you’re not confident in your mechanical skills, consider purchasing a kit with detailed instructions or consulting a small engine repair guide before starting.
Another factor is whether the governor is a direct drop-in replacement or requires modification. OEM and high-quality aftermarket parts should bolt on without alterations. Universal or poorly designed units may require bending linkages or drilling new holes, which can compromise performance and safety. Always test-fit the assembly before fully tightening bolts or reassembling components.

Frequently Asked Questions
Q: Why does my GCV160 start but then die immediately?
A: This is a classic symptom of a faulty governor assembly. The governor regulates engine speed by adjusting the throttle based on load. If it’s stuck, misaligned, or damaged, the engine may fire up but can’t sustain idle or respond to demand, causing it to stall. Other causes could include a clogged carburetor, bad fuel, or ignition issues, but the governor is a common culprit.
Q: Can I clean or repair my existing governor instead of replacing it?
A: In some cases, yes—especially if the issue is dirt, corrosion, or a loose linkage. You can try disassembling the governor, cleaning it with carburetor cleaner, and lubricating moving parts. However, if springs are worn, levers are bent, or internal components are damaged, replacement is usually the best option. Cleaning is a temporary fix at best.
Q: How do I know if the governor is the problem?
A: Start by ruling out other common causes: check fuel quality, air filter condition, and spark plug functionality. If the engine starts but dies under load or at idle, and you notice erratic RPM fluctuations, the governor is likely at fault. A visual inspection can also reveal loose linkages, broken springs, or worn parts.

Q: What’s the difference between a mechanical and electronic governor?
A: The GCV160 uses a mechanical governor, which relies on centrifugal force and springs to control throttle position. Electronic governors use sensors and actuators, but they’re not used on this engine model. Stick with mechanical replacements for compatibility.
